WebDec 14, 2024 · Lake Michigan is filled with many dangerous animals, however it is quite unlikely that sharks are one of them. The temperature of the Great Lakes, as well as the weather surrounding them, is actually quite low with water temperatures ranging from between 41-48 F (5-9 C).

WebCurrently, 20 states have what can be called "comprehensive bans." These bans typically classify wild cats, large non-domesticated carnivores, reptiles, and non-human primates as "dangerous animals" or otherwise prohibit private ownership of these species. WebDangerous Animals: Public Act 426 of 1988 Sets policy regarding dangerous animals by providing for the confinement, tattooing, or destruction of dangerous animals and outlining penalties for the owners or keepers of dangerous animals that attack human beings.
